Zoox has embarked on a highly ambitious journey to develop a fullstack autonomous mobility solution for our cities. As a technical program manager you will work crossfunctionally with engineering and product leaders to make cybersecurity an integral part of both their longterm plans and tactical work despite conflicting priorities and tight schedules.
On one side you will make it easy for teams to say yes to security initiatives by developing project schedules identifying milestones flagging risks estimating budgets and clearly communicating priorities and progress. On the other side you will facilitate work of Product Security teams by aligning team capabilities and availability to needs projects priorities and timelines; by relentlessly overcommunicating what you did are doing and plan to do; and by critically examining finetuning and suggesting tools and processes teams use to get things done.
The Product Security organization at Zoox is a specialist multiteam group that focuses on the cybersecurity aspects of anything related to the core Zoox product our mobility service. Product Security serves a number of engineering teams across software hardware vehicle engineering and other divisions. The group collaborates with and implements the policy of Zooxwide information security and governance organizations.
In this role you will:
Work with engineering teams product teams and leaders to translate corporate strategy into detailed product roadmaps timelines and deliverables while driving cybersecurity initiatives across connected vehicle systems
Drive product security initiatives across connected vehicle systems ensuring protection of invehicle networks telematics and cloudbased services and own programs such as product risk assessment and management incident response and continuous monitoring for various company milestones.
Create and deliver technical presentations that explain program initiatives and establish standard reports for effective stakeholder communications on program status issues/risks and accomplishments
Partner with crossfunctional teams (engineering product security policy/legal) to design and implement secure architectures and integrate cybersecurity protocols into vehicle development processes
Analyze and report on deployed security tools and provide information needed for the development of security products to all stakeholders
As a senior member of the Program Management organization set meeting agendas to eliminate bottlenecks model Zoox values ensure diverse voices are heard and help develop the next generation of Program Management specialists

Compensation and Benefits
There are three major components to compensation for this position: salary Amazon Restricted Stock Units (RSUs) and Zoox Stock Appreciation Rights. The salary will range from $197000 to $236000. A signon bonus may be part of a compensation package. Compensation will vary based on geographic location jobrelated knowledge skills and experience.
Zoox also offers a comprehensive package of benefits including paid time off (e.g. sick leave vacation bereavement) unpaid time off Zoox Stock Appreciation Rights Amazon RSUs health insurance longterm care insurance longterm and shortterm disability insurance and life insurance.
